New School Bid Sets Stage for Fall Opening
Final summer work on the new Lincoln Street school includes four classrooms a biology lab science rooms study hall music room and a two room commercial department with library and multi purpose areas. The exterior stone facing overlooks Edwin F Deicke Park and a secretarys office and PES room along with a meeting space are included.

Huntley School Summer Reading Program Opens
The Huntley Consolidated School launches a summer reading program on June 19 with 91 students from elementary and junior high. It runs daily from 9 to 12, ends July 28, and focuses on personal reading improvement with new materials and outside expert seminars.

State Rep Pierce Criticizes Budget Cut at Grove School Ceremony
State Representative Daniel M. Pierce spoke at Grove School mortgage burning in Lake Forest warning the Illinois House cut $42 million from the Department of Mental Health budget for the coming biennium. The privately supported brain injured children’s school recently expanded to Ridge Farm on Old Mill Road.

Fireworks Stolen From Huntley Area Storage Shed
About 3500 dollars worth of fireworks were taken from a storage shed of the Carpentersville Fireworks Co south of Huntley in Powder Park. Lt Madsen of the McHenry County Sheriff's Department investigates and awaits an inventory. Authorities urge anyone with tips to call.

School Board meeting approves budget and new staff
The School Board of Education of Schroads held a June 20 meeting with all members present. They approved a contract for Bonnie ive to reach 3rd grade and the 1967 68 teacher budget of 19 633 dollars, unchanged except for adding a new mechanics course. The board authorized purchasing sewing machines and cabinets for 900 dollars and new equipment for the commercial department including three Commodore adding machines two transcribing machines a dictaphone a Victor calculator six Olympic typewriters and a mimeograph model 320 duplicator.

Children Receive Bibles In Church Recognition
Sunday worship at United Church of Christ Congregational featured Bible presentations for Sunday School children entering third grade this fall. Ed Williams, Religious Education Board chairman, presented the Bibles to Scott Andersen, Terry Cork, Melanie Eckman, David Hardy, Lawrence Hellmuth, Poisson, and others.
